package com.naryx.tagfusion.expression.function.ls;
import java.text.DateFormat;
import java.util.List;
import com.naryx.tagfusion.cfm.engine.cfCatchData;
import com.naryx.tagfusion.cfm.engine.cfData;
import com.naryx.tagfusion.cfm.engine.cfSession;
import com.naryx.tagfusion.cfm.engine.cfStringData;
import com.naryx.tagfusion.cfm.engine.cfmRunTimeException;
import com.naryx.tagfusion.expression.function.functionBase;
public class LSTimeFormat extends functionBase {
private static final long serialVersionUID = 1L;
public LSTimeFormat() {
min = 1;
max = 2;
}
public String[] getParamInfo() {
return new String[] { "date1", "format string; short cuts ('short', 'medium', 'long', 'full') or customized string" };
}
public java.util.Map getInfo() {
return makeInfo("locale", "Formats a time string to a given output using the current session locale", ReturnType.STRING);
}
public cfData execute(cfSession _session, List<cfData> parameters) throws cfmRunTimeException {
cfData d1;
String formatString;
if (parameters.size() == 2) {
// Retrieve the time parameter
d1 = parameters.get(1);
if (d1.getString().equals(""))
return new cfStringData("");
// Retrieve the mask parameter
formatString = parameters.get(0).getString();
if (formatString.equalsIgnoreCase("short")) {
DateFormat df = DateFormat.getTimeInstance(DateFormat.SHORT, _session.getLocale());
String s = df.format(new java.util.Date(d1.getDateData().getLong()));
return new cfStringData(s);
} else if (formatString.equalsIgnoreCase("medium")) {
DateFormat df = DateFormat.getTimeInstance(DateFormat.MEDIUM, _session.getLocale());
String s = df.format(new java.util.Date(d1.getDateData().getLong()));
return new cfStringData(s);
} else if (formatString.equalsIgnoreCase("long")) {
DateFormat df = DateFormat.getTimeInstance(DateFormat.LONG, _session.getLocale());
String s = df.format(new java.util.Date(d1.getDateData().getLong()));
return new cfStringData(s);
} else if (formatString.equalsIgnoreCase("full")) {
DateFormat df = DateFormat.getTimeInstance(DateFormat.FULL, _session.getLocale());
String s = df.format(new java.util.Date(d1.getDateData().getLong()));
return new cfStringData(s);
}
} else {
// Retrieve the time parameter
d1 = parameters.get(0);
if (d1.getString().equals(""))
return new cfStringData("");
// The default is short
String s = DateFormat.getTimeInstance(DateFormat.SHORT, _session.getLocale()).format(new java.util.Date(d1.getDateData().getLong()));
return new cfStringData(s);
}
// If we reach here then it's a custom format string.
try {
// Get the formattedTime
String formattedTime = com.nary.util.Date.cfmlFormatTime(d1.getDateData().getLong(), formatString, _session.getLocale());
// Return the formatted time
return new cfStringData(formattedTime);
} catch (IllegalArgumentException e) {
cfCatchData catchData = new cfCatchData(_session);
catchData.setType("Function");
catchData.setDetail("timeFormat");
catchData.setMessage("Invalid time mask " + parameters.get(0).getString()); // note
// this
// assumes
// that
// the
// default
// formatString
// is
// valid.
throw new cfmRunTimeException(catchData);
} catch (cfmRunTimeException e) {
throwException(_session, "invalid date/time string:" + parameters.get(0).getString());
}
return null;
}
}
